Definition of MACRON

macron

Plural: macra, macrons

Noun

  • A diacritical mark (¯) placed over a vowel to indicate a long sound.
  • a diacritical mark (-) placed above a vowel to indicate a long sound
  • A short, straight, horizontal diacritical mark (◌̄) placed over a letter, usually to indicate that the pronunciation of a vowel is long.

Origin / Etymology

From Ancient Greek μακρόν (makrón), neuter form of μακρός (makrós, “long”) (English macro-).

Antonyms

breve, micron
